Word Pattern Recognition

See the structure of English at a glance.

English words follow predictable patterns. Recognising common letter sequences, blends, and shapes lets you generate candidates faster than brute-force scanning. This hub trains your pattern intuition.

What you will learn

  • Recognise high-frequency bigrams and trigrams instantly
  • Predict likely letter positions from partial information
  • Convert green/yellow clues into a short candidate list
